Hi. You can only get pregnant NEAR ovulation time. That is around 5 days before, and up to 2 days afterwards. Most women don’t know exactly when ovulation will occur (hour, minute etc) and sperm can live inside of the female for up to 5 days. So if you are having unprotected sex, you WILL get pregnant eventually. The sperm could be there and awaiting for your egg, fertilize it and you’ll be pregnant.
If you take your pill late often, then yes ovulation could occur. The pill can’t even protect you 100% against pregnancy to begin with, so always use another method of birth control if you are not wanting to become pregnant.
